Bears' Tremaine Edmunds: Looking likely to return
Edmunds (groin) is likely to be activated from injured reserve ahead of Saturday's game against the Packers, Jeremy Fowler of ESPN.com reports.
Edmunds has been sidelined since Week 12, but he logged two limited practices and a full session in preparation for Saturday's pivotal NFC North matchup. He'll still need to be officially activated from injured reserve to be able to return, though all signs point to him being on the field in Week 16.

Bears' Tremaine Edmunds: Questionable after full practice
Edmunds (groin) is listed as questionable for Saturday's game against the Packers after practicing fully Thursday.
Edmunds' full participation Thursday bodes well for his chances of suiting up for Saturday's pivotal matchup, but the linebacker would first need to be added back to the roster from injured reserve in order to be eligible to play. His practice window to return from IR was opened Monday, and Edmunds subsequently put forth a pair of limited practices before upgrading to full participation Thursday.

Bears' Tremaine Edmunds: Limited in return to practice
Edmunds (groin) was a limited participant in Tuesday's walkthrough practice.
Edmunds missed the Bears' last four games due to a groin injury, but he was designated to return from IR on Monday and has progressed enough in his recovery to participate in practice, albeit in a limited capacity during Tuesday's walkthrough. He would need to be activated from IR in order to be available for Saturday's NFC North tilt against the Packers. D'Marco Jackson has started in each of the Bears' last four games, but he would likely revert to a rotational role on defense and contributor on special teams once Edmunds is cleared to return.

Bears' Tremaine Edmunds: Won't play Sunday
Edmunds (groin) has been ruled out ahead of Sunday's matchup against the Steelers.
The 27-year-old didn't practice all week due to a groin injury and is now in line to miss his first game of the season Sunday. Edmunds is an integral part of the Bears' defense, recording 89 total tackles and nine passes defensed, including four interceptions, over 10 appearances this year. While he's out in Week 12, expect Ruben Hyppolite to have an expanded role on Chicago's defense.

Bears' Tremaine Edmunds: Three tackles in Week 8
Edmunds recorded three tackles (two solo) in the Bears' loss to the Ravens on Sunday.
Despite playing 94 percent of the defensive snaps, Edmunds did very little in the box score, as his three tackles were easily Edmunds' fewest of the season. On the year, he's recorded 64 tackles (32 solo), including 1.0 sacks, and five pass breakups, including three interceptions.

Bears' Tremaine Edmunds: Posts limited session Thursday
Edmunds (ankle) was limited in practice Thursday.
Edmunds wasn't listed on Wednesday's injury report, so he appears to either be having his reps capped for maintenance reasons or to have sustained an ankle issue during practice. The starting linebacker has been a valuable fantasy contributor this season for IDP purposes, with 61 tackles (60 solo), including 1.0 sacks, plus four pass breakups, including three INTs, so his status will warrant monitoring closely. Unless Edmunds can resume practicing in full Friday, he'll likely be assigned an injury designation for Sunday's road matchup against the Ravens.
